版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025年项目软技术试题及答案一、单项选择题(每题2分,共20分)1.某软件项目采用Scrum框架,冲刺周期为2周,当前冲刺已进行5天,剩余工作量从40个故事点降至28个,燃尽图显示实际进度线低于计划线。此时最可能的问题是()。A.团队在冲刺中期调整了故事点估算规则B.部分任务因依赖外部接口未完成导致延期C.产品负责人(PO)临时增加了高优先级需求D.测试团队因资源不足未及时介入开发环节2.需求工程中,使用Kano模型对用户需求分类时,“用户未明确提出但期待的功能”属于()。A.基本型需求B.期望型需求C.兴奋型需求D.无差异需求3.项目风险管理中,采用概率-影响矩阵评估风险时,某风险发生概率为30%,影响等级为“严重(导致项目延期20%)”,该风险应被划分为()。A.低风险(绿色区域)B.中等风险(黄色区域)C.高风险(红色区域)D.关键风险(黑色区域)4.敏捷团队中,“通过可视化看板限制在制品(WIP)数量”的主要目的是()。A.减少多任务切换带来的效率损耗B.强制团队优先完成高优先级任务C.确保每个任务的完成质量D.便于产品负责人跟踪进度5.变更管理流程中,“变更影响分析”的核心输出是()。A.变更请求的优先级排序B.变更对项目范围、时间、成本的综合影响评估C.变更实施的具体技术方案D.变更涉及的利益相关方名单6.某远程开发团队使用Jira进行任务管理,发现任务状态更新滞后,成员间信息同步效率低。最有效的改进措施是()。A.增加每日站会的时长至60分钟B.在看板中设置“进行中”状态的WIP限制为3C.要求成员在任务状态变更时@相关协作人D.引入自动化通知功能(如状态变更触发企业微信提醒)7.软件质量保证(SQA)的核心活动不包括()。A.审查开发过程是否符合规范B.执行单元测试并记录缺陷C.评估质量目标的达成情况D.制定质量保证计划8.项目沟通管理中,“沟通渠道数”计算公式为n(n-1)/2,其中n指()。A.项目团队成员数量B.项目利益相关方数量C.需传递的信息种类数量D.关键决策点数量9.采用DevOps模式的项目中,“持续集成(CI)”的关键指标是()。A.代码提交到构建成功的时间B.测试用例的覆盖率C.生产环境部署的频率D.缺陷修复的平均时间10.需求验证时,“通过用户原型测试收集反馈”属于()方法。A.静态验证(文档审查)B.动态验证(执行测试)C.专家评审D.需求追溯二、多项选择题(每题3分,共15分,少选得1分,错选不得分)11.敏捷项目中,产品待办列表(ProductBacklog)的特征包括()。A.动态更新,优先级随业务目标调整B.所有条目需在项目启动前完全定义C.高层级条目(如史诗故事)需分解为用户故事D.包含技术任务(如重构代码)和缺陷修复任务12.项目冲突管理的策略中,“合作(Collaborate)”适用于()场景。A.冲突涉及长期利益且双方均需满意B.时间紧迫需快速决策C.双方目标一致但方法不同D.一方权力明显高于另一方13.需求跟踪矩阵的作用包括()。A.确保每个需求都有对应的测试用例B.识别需求变更对下游工作的影响C.验证需求与业务目标的对齐性D.统计需求的实现进度14.团队建设的“形成-震荡-规范-成熟-解散”模型中,“震荡阶段”的典型表现有()。A.成员间因工作方式差异产生摩擦B.团队开始建立明确的规则和流程C.对项目目标的理解存在分歧D.成员主动分享经验并协作解决问题15.软件项目估算中,“功能点分析法(FPA)”的输入包括()。A.外部输入(EI)数量B.代码行数(LOC)C.外部查询(EQ)数量D.用户故事的复杂度等级三、案例分析题(每题15分,共30分)案例1:某互联网公司启动“智能客服系统”开发项目,采用Scrum框架,团队包括产品经理(兼PO)、开发5人、测试2人、ScrumMaster(由技术主管兼任)。前3个冲刺(6周)完成了基础对话模块和用户管理模块,但存在以下问题:冲刺评审时,用户反馈“对话逻辑不符合真实客服场景”;测试团队在冲刺后期集中介入,导致30%的用户故事因缺陷未修复无法“完成”;开发团队抱怨“产品经理频繁在冲刺中要求调整用户故事优先级”。问题:分析上述问题的根本原因,并提出改进措施。案例2:某企业级软件项目进入验收阶段,客户突然提出新增“跨系统数据同步”功能(原需求文档未包含),要求2周内完成,否则拒绝验收。项目当前进度已延迟1周,剩余预算仅为原计划的15%。问题:(1)从变更管理流程角度,应如何处理该变更请求?(2)若客户坚持要求实现,项目团队可采取哪些应对策略?四、简答题(每题6分,共30分)16.简述敏捷开发中“完成的定义(DoD)”的作用及关键要素。17.需求工程中,“需求elicitation(获取)”与“需求validation(验证)”的区别是什么?18.项目风险管理中,“风险登记册”应包含哪些核心信息?19.远程团队协作中,如何通过工具组合提升沟通效率?(列举3种工具及对应场景)20.质量管理中,“预防成本”与“缺陷成本”的关系是什么?举例说明。五、论述题(每题15分,共30分)21.传统瀑布模型与敏捷开发在需求管理上的差异主要体现在哪些方面?结合具体项目场景说明各自的适用条件。22.随着AI技术的发展(如需求提供工具、自动测试框架),项目软技术(如需求工程、质量管理、团队协作)可能发生哪些变革?请从至少两个维度展开论述。答案及解析一、单项选择题1.B。燃尽图实际进度线低于计划线(剩余工作量高于计划),说明进度滞后。冲刺中期通常不会调整估算规则(A),PO在冲刺中不应增加需求(C),测试延迟多影响后期(D),最可能是任务依赖导致延期。2.C。Kano模型中,兴奋型需求是用户未明确但惊喜的功能,基本型是必须有的,期望型是用户明确要求的。3.B。概率30%(中)×严重影响(高)通常落入中等风险区域(黄色),具体矩阵需结合组织标准,但常规划分中此组合为中等。4.A。限制WIP主要减少多任务切换(上下文切换成本),提升单任务处理效率。5.B。变更影响分析需评估对范围、时间、成本、质量等的综合影响,是决策的关键依据。6.D。远程团队信息同步滞后的核心是通知不及时,自动化提醒可实时同步状态,比延长会议(A)或限制WIP(B)更直接。7.B。单元测试属于开发活动,SQA关注过程合规性,不直接执行测试。8.B。沟通渠道数计算的是利益相关方之间的潜在沟通路径,n为相关方数量。9.A。CI的关键是快速反馈,代码提交到构建成功的时间(构建周期)是核心指标。10.B。用户原型测试是通过实际执行(动态)验证需求是否符合预期。二、多项选择题11.ACD。产品待办列表动态更新(A),高层级条目需分解(C),包含技术任务(D);启动前无法完全定义(B错误)。12.AC。合作策略适用于需长期关系、双方目标一致但方法不同的场景;时间紧迫用强制(B错误),权力不对等用妥协(D错误)。13.ABCD。需求跟踪矩阵覆盖需求到测试、影响分析、对齐业务目标、进度统计。14.AC。震荡阶段表现为摩擦、分歧;规范阶段建立规则(B错误),成熟阶段主动协作(D错误)。15.AC。功能点分析基于外部输入(EI)、外部输出(EO)、外部查询(EQ)等数据,不直接依赖代码行数(B)或用户故事复杂度(D)。三、案例分析题案例1答案要点:根本原因:需求获取不充分(用户反馈场景不符,说明PO未深入用户调研);测试介入延迟(Scrum要求“完成”的故事需可发布,测试应全程参与);PO违反Scrum规则(冲刺中不应调整优先级,冲刺待办列表由开发团队主导)。改进措施:增加用户访谈、场景模拟等需求获取活动,PO需在冲刺计划前与用户确认故事细节;测试人员全程参与冲刺,在开发过程中同步编写测试用例,早发现缺陷;ScrumMaster需引导PO遵守冲刺承诺,变更需求需在冲刺结束后通过产品待办列表重新排序。案例2答案要点:(1)变更管理流程处理步骤:①记录变更请求(CR),明确新增功能的具体需求;②进行影响分析(评估需2周完成的工作量、所需资源、对现有进度/预算的影响);③提交变更控制委员会(CCB)评审,判断是否接受变更(原需求未包含,且项目已延迟、预算不足,可拒绝);④若拒绝,与客户沟通验收标准,协商替代方案(如后续版本实现);若接受,更新项目计划、预算,并获得客户确认。(2)客户坚持时的应对策略:范围压缩:与客户协商优先级,仅实现核心同步功能(如基础数据传输,暂不支持复杂校验);资源优化:调配团队加班或引入外部专家(需评估成本);风险转移:与客户签订补充协议,明确新增功能导致的延期和成本超支由客户承担;快速验证:采用原型法快速开发最简可用版本(MVP),降低开发时间。四、简答题16.作用:定义“完成”的统一标准,确保团队对可交付物质量达成共识,避免“部分完成”导致的返工。关键要素:代码通过单元测试、集成测试;文档更新;通过PO和用户评审;缺陷修复至可发布水平。17.需求获取(elicitation)是从用户/利益相关方收集需求的过程(如访谈、问卷);需求验证(validation)是确认需求是否正确、完整、可行的过程(如原型测试、专家评审)。前者是“收集”,后者是“确认”。18.核心信息:风险ID、风险描述、概率/影响评估、风险等级、应对策略(规避/减轻/转移/接受)、责任人、状态(已处理/监控中)。19.示例:①腾讯会议(视频会议)用于每日站会、冲刺评审,支持屏幕共享和实时讨论;②飞书文档(协作编辑)用于需求文档共同编写,记录版本变更;③企业微信(即时通讯)用于日常问题快速沟通,设置“开发-测试”专属群同步缺陷状态。20.关系:预防成本(如需求评审、培训)增加可降低缺陷成本(如返工、客户投诉)。例:投入5万元进行需求原型测试(预防),避免后期因需求错误导致20万元的返工成本(缺陷成本)。五、论述题21.差异体现:①需求确定性:瀑布模型要求需求完整冻结后启动开发,适用于需求明确、变更少的场景(如传统ERP实施);敏捷接受需求变更,通过迭代逐步细化,适用于需求模糊、快速变化的场景(如互联网产品开发)。②验证频率:瀑布在阶段末尾验证需求(如测试阶段),易导致后期大规模返工;敏捷在每个冲刺评审时与用户验证,及时调整。③文档要求:瀑布需要详细的需求规格说明书;敏捷仅保留必要文档(如用户故事卡),强调“可工作的软件优于详尽的文档”。22.变革维度示例:①需求工程:AI工具(如ChatGPT辅助需求提供)可自动分析用
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 消毒管理培训制度
- 产康培训生管理制度
- 放疗三基培训与考核制度
- 员工轮岗培训制度
- 库管员培训制度
- 教师外出培训财务制度
- 岗位风险预控培训制度
- 化验员培训制度
- 加油站培训制度
- 舞蹈培训机构激励制度
- 2026天津市津南创腾经济开发有限公司招聘8人笔试参考题库及答案解析
- 特种作业培训课件模板
- 2025年时事政治知识考试试题题库试题附答案完整版
- 高校宿舍管理员培训课件
- 河南省开封市2026届高三年级第一次质量检测历史试题卷+答案
- 员工通勤安全培训课件
- 岁末年初安全知识培训课件
- 全国秸秆综合利用重点县秸秆还田监测工作方案
- 吞咽障碍患者误吸的预防与管理方案
- 中小企业人才流失问题及对策分析
- 2026年湖南铁路科技职业技术学院单招职业倾向性测试题库含答案
评论
0/150
提交评论